We all know that soon enough these mangas are going to end, and for me its hard to find a good story that will grab my attention and also make me stick with it. Naruto is a great manga, it has some flaws with some of the plots holes, but overall it is a great manga: the plot is great, there's alot of character development thats one of its big aspects and also its very motivating and i think in some way shape or form ppl can relate to it, basically having a dream or goal in life and trying to go for it no matter what. Naruto will be missed.

Bleach is just awesome, the plot is not all that great, tite makes a lot of mistakes with his character development and he does have a lot of plot holes that make you question his writing abilites. Overall though bleach is awesome, the shinigami with there zanpakutos and the whole bankai thing even the names of there zanpakutos is just cool. I also like how there techniques have cool names like ichigo's getsuga tensho and byakua's senkei, gokei, and shukei, its doesnt get any better than that. Bleach has a lot of great aspects about it mainly pertaining to the abilities, the fighting, and also the personalities he puts into the characters. And lets not to forget the espada/arrancar. Bleach is on its last volume :mad:

Im not really a big fan of one piece, from what i read its okay, some people might say different. We all have different taste, its just that one piece does grab my attention like bleach and naruto does. I think the abilities are okay but sometimes the characters can be a bit silly and i really cant take it serious. And also the climactic scenes can take a while to work up. But the idea of turning pirates into something on a large scale, does take some skill and for ppl to like it, i really cant say anything too negative about it. For me one piece is something i have to watch rather than read.

There are a other good manga ive read like fma and vagabond. But i just wonder what will be the next big thing after our favorites have ended. What do you think? Please share
